How we use your data

​Friends Without Borders does not make public any personal information without getting the permission of those concerned. We do not sell client, supporter or volunteer lists.

Our Supporters

Consent is sought by all supporters subscribed to our email list to receive copies of our "Occaisional News", and other updates.

​In the case of supporters emails these are sent “blind”. It is our policy to remove supporters’ details from our distribution lists upon request. This policy is advertised with the contact information at the bottom of official emails.

​All supporters are given the opportunity to opt out of communications relating to fundraising.

Our Volunteers

In the case of volunteers contact information is shared with other volunteers in order that they may communicate with each other. Group emails are sent “en clair” with volunteers able to see each others’ email addresses.

Volunteer applications and personal data are held securely in files, in accordance with the UK GDPR and as outlined in our data retention and disposal policy.

Our Clients

In the case of clients our database information is securely stored with your express permission and is available only to limited volunteers. It is our policy to remove clients’ details from our distribution lists upon their request.

We seek regular approval from you, in order to store your personal data for the purposes of offering you support and advocating on your behalf. We will not share your personal data without asking your permission.
These policies were considered by trustees and approved on 22nd March 2021. A copy of our Privacy Policy is available below.
